> 3 versions?  Any hint as to what they are all "called"?
Those three are for versions of three different firmware, boot, primary and 
secondary.
Will fix it my moving enum enum_fw_mode from patch 5/6 here and use it as
struct version_info version[FW2 + 1];

+enum enum_fw_mode {
+       BOOT,   /* bootloader */
+       FW1,    /* FW partition-1 (contains secondary fw) */
+       FW2,    /* FW partition-2 (contains primary fw) */
+       FW_INVALID,
+};
